mirror of
https://github.com/espressif/esp-idf.git
synced 2024-10-05 20:47:46 -04:00
72e67e3cf7
- GCM operation in mbedtls used ECB, which calculated only 16 bytes of data each time. - Therefore, when processing a large amount of data, it is necessary to frequently set hardware acceleration calculations, - which could not make good use of the AES DMA function to improve efficiency. - Hence, GCM implementation is replaced with CTR-based calculation which utilizes AES DMA to improve efficiency. |
||
---|---|---|
.. | ||
crts | ||
CMakeLists.txt | ||
component.mk | ||
test_aes_gcm.c | ||
test_aes_perf.c | ||
test_aes_sha_parallel.c | ||
test_aes_sha_rsa.c | ||
test_aes.c | ||
test_apb_dport_access.c | ||
test_apb_dport_access.h | ||
test_ecp.c | ||
test_esp_crt_bundle.c | ||
test_mbedtls_mpi.c | ||
test_mbedtls_sha.c | ||
test_mbedtls.c | ||
test_rsa.c | ||
test_sha_perf.c | ||
test_sha.c |